New Top Gear presenter Matt LeBlanc was surprised by all the media attention when it became known that he is the new host would be. This explains the 48-year-old actor in an interview with his co-host Chris Evans on the Uk radio. By LeBlanc as a presenter, he is officially the first non-British host in the 39-year-old existence of the English programme of entertainment.

In the interview, says LeBlanc already had a phone call have had of F1 driver Romain Grosjean who like it would want to take to the show. Invite yourself for an interview, yes, that can also. Also, actor Stephen Mangan, we may see again in the show.

Matt is an absolute Porsche-fanboy, and he thinks that his 911 (997) GT2 is not easily surpassed, when it comes to rear-wheel drive cars. The GT2 is so good that he even scared, according to the Friends actor. He describes the Porsche as the most daily usable supercar ever. In the conversation between Evans and LeBlanc was also known that there is a roadtrip will be recorded in South Africa. Top Gear appears in may on the tube.
